That's why these shipping companies offer optional insurance (on value up to a limit of U$1500 usually) at a small extra cost (U$50 on U$1500). If not, missing items have become not such an uncommon occurence with any of even the bigger companies, such as Fastway and Confianca. (The fly-by-night ones are represented by the company whose hundreds of cartons were recently found in a storage locker near Boston. Police are trying to locate the carton owners.) After experiencing these 'disappearances', one friend has taken to wrapping every inch of the entire carton in clear tape, to try to reproduce the plastic wrapping service offered at some airports. So far, it seems to be working.
